I did not know anything about the 'Shiseido Company" so I did a little reading up on it. This little segment is from wiki-
"Shiseido Company, Limited, is a major Japanese hair care and cosmetics producer. It is one of the oldest cosmetics companies in the world. Founded in 1872, it celebrated its 140th year anniversary in 2012.It is the largest cosmetic firm in Japan and the fourth largest cosmetics company in the world."Comment
